Girl on the Third Floor (2019): A Haunting Dive into Psychological Horror
Overview
Girl on the Third Floor is a 2019 psychological horror film that delves deep into themes of guilt, redemption, and supernatural terror. Directed and written by Travis Stevens, this film offers a modern horror experience filled with tension, eerie atmosphere, and psychologically unsettling moments. With a compelling mix of horror and drama, Girl on the Third Floor has made a mark within the 2019 Hollywood movie landscape.
Synopsis
The plot centers on Don Koch, a man with a troubled past, who attempts to start fresh by renovating an old, dilapidated Victorian house in a small town with the hope of fixing his troubled life and reconnecting with his pregnant wife. However, the house harbors dark secrets tied to its violent history, and the renovation process becomes a supernatural nightmare. As Don immerses himself in fixing up the house, paranormal events escalate, forcing him to confront his own inner demons and the sinister forces rooted within the home itself.

Director and Writer
Travis Stevens both directed and penned the screenplay for Girl on the Third Floor. Known for his skill in crafting suspenseful and character-driven stories, Stevens employs a slow-building tension approach that is effective in unsettling the audience without relying purely on jump scares or gore. His dual role as writer and director allowed for a cohesive vision that blends psychological drama with traditional haunted house tropes.
Production and Cinematography
The film’s visual style is marked by an ominous mood supporting the horror genre, capturing the run-down beauty of the Victorian house with shadows that suggest lurking danger and the past’s dark weight. Cinematographer Christian M. Goldsmith contributed to creating an immersive, claustrophobic feel that mirrors the protagonist’s psychological state. The set design and practical effects enhance the vintage and decayed environment, making the house itself feel like a malevolent character.
Themes and Tone
Girl on the Third Floor explores guilt, redemption, and the consequences of past actions. Don Koch's effort to renovate the house parallels his attempt to rebuild his own life, indicating that certain scars run deeper than surface-level fixes. The film fuses psychological horror with supernatural elements, creating a layered narrative where the true terror lies not only in ghostly apparitions but also in confronting one’s inner darkness.
Reception
The movie received generally positive reviews from horror enthusiasts and critics who praised CM Punk’s performance, the film’s atmospheric dread, and its unique blend of grounded emotional storytelling with horror elements. While it may fly under the radar compared to mainstream horror releases, Girl on the Third Floor has gained a cult following for its fresh take on haunted house horror, avoiding typical clichés and delivering something more psychologically complex.
